How did ancient Egyptians prepare jewelry I need answer ASAP

Social Studies
1 answer:
Marta_Voda [28]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:Everyone wore jewellery in ancient Egypt, from poor farmers to wealthy royals. For the wealthy, pieces were made from semi-precious stones, precious metals and glass beads. The poor substituted these with painted clay, stones, shells, animal teeth and bones.

Ok the ancient Egyptians made many different types of jewellery. Craftsmen created necklaces, bracelets, collars, earrings and more from gold, stones and glass. ... For instance to make a necklace, one person would make the beads, another would drill the holes in the beads, and a third would thread them onto papyrus string.    Hope this helps have a great night ❤️❤️❤️
